Introduction
Protecting your home's water supply from contamination is crucial, and backflow prevention plays a vital role in Brunswick, GA. Backflow occurs when contaminated water reverses its flow, potentially mixing with your clean drinking water. Installing and maintaining backflow prevention devices ensures the safety and purity of your household's water. Key Cost Factors
- Type of Service: A basic backflow test is significantly less expensive than a full installation or repair. Testing can range from $30 to $85, while installation can be $300 to $1200.
- Device Type: Different backflow preventer devices come with varying costs. More complex devices required for higher-risk situations will be pricier.
- Accessibility: If the backflow preventer is in a hard-to-reach location, or requires excavation for below-ground units, labor costs can increase.
- Repairs vs. Installation: Repairing an existing backflow preventer is often less costly than installing a completely new unit, unless the damage is extensive.
- Permit Requirements: Some installations may require permits, which add to the overall cost.

Tips for Hiring
- Request Multiple Quotes: Always — for example, from Yelp-listed providers — and compare at least three different quotes for backflow prevention services to ensure you're getting a fair price. Be sure to ask about all included services, like parts and labor.
- Verify Certifications and Licensing: Ensure that any plumber or backflow tester you hire is properly licensed and certified in Georgia. The Georgia Association of Water Professionals (GAWP) offers backflow tester certification.
- Check References and Reviews: Look for companies with positive reviews and strong references. Companies like Canady's in Savannah/Beaufort indicate the importance of professional service for such tasks.
- Inquire About Warranties: Ask if the installation or repair comes with a warranty on both parts and labor. This can provide peace of mind and protection against future issues.
